Baldy Mountain
Baldy Mountain is a peak in Town of Tyringham, Berkshire, Massachusetts and has an elevation of 1,873 feet. Baldy Mountain is situated nearby to the hamlet Tyringham, as well as near West Becket.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Peak with an elevation of 1,873 feet
- Description: mountain in Massachusetts, United States of America
- Also known as: “Millinery Hill”

Tyringham Cobble
Nature reserve

Tyringham Cobble is a 206-acre open space reservation located in Tyringham, Massachusetts on 411 m Cobble Hill in The Berkshires. It is managed by The Trustees of Reservations, a non-profit conservation organization, and is notable for its scenic views over the rural landscape of Tyringham Valley from rocky ledges and open fields.
Tyringham Cemetery
Cemetery

Tyringham Cemetery is a historic cemetery section just outside the historic center of Tyringham, Massachusetts. The 3.67 acres property lies on the west side of Church Street, opposite the Union Church.
McLennan Reservation
Nature reserve
McLennan Reservation is a nature reserve located in Otis and Tyringham, Massachusetts. The property is owned by The Trustees of Reservations through a series of endowments for preserving the land, the first in 1977.
